What you will do:
  • Be a trusted member of the engagement team providing various assurance and consulting services to industry specific clients:
  • Proactively engage with your clients throughout the year to gather needed information to complete testing and respond to questions raised.
  • Plan and supervise the execution of all audit engagement activities.
  • Review and perform substantive testing on client's balance sheets and income statements.
  • Conduct and review tests to assess deficiencies of internal controls and make recommendations for improvement.
  • Play an active role in discussions with the Manager and Partner relative to business recommendations resulting from testing performed and information gathered.
  • Learn and grow from direct on the job coaching and mentoring along with participating in firm wide learning and development programs.

The pay rate ranges for this job position are posted below. Actual compensation is influenced by a variety of relevant factors including but not limited to applicant's skills, prior experience, qualifications, degrees, professional certifications, work arrangements and geographic location. Baker Tilly offers a comprehensive compensation and benefits package to eligible employees: Life at Baker Tilly | Baker Tilly
  • In Rancho Cordova/Sacramento (CA): the pay rate range is $91,000 to $145,350
  • In Fresno (CA): the pay rate range is $79,400 to $108,900
